NeoGenomics (NEO) Provides 2025 Financial Guidance and Updates Long-Range Financial Plan

January 15, 2025 10:17 AM EST

NeoGenomics, Inc. (“NeoGenomics” or the “Company”) (NASDAQ: NEO), a leading oncology testing services company, today provided financial guidance for fiscal year 2025 and updated its Long-Range Financial Plan.

“We enter 2025 with our patient-centric strategy in place, focusing on product innovation, further optimization and expansion of our commercial organization, and enhancing operational efficiencies,” said Chris Smith, chief executive officer of NeoGenomics. “Building on the strong momentum of double-digit revenue growth and margin expansion we have delivered over the last few years, we are updating our Long-Range Plan and now expect revenue growth of 12-13% annually, while expanding our leadership position in oncology testing.”

2025 Financial Guidance

NeoGenomics is providing financial guidance1 for 2025. The Company expects total revenues in the range of $735 million to $745 million and adjusted EBITDA in the range of $55 million to $58 million.

With a strong cash position, we currently expect to retire the 2025 convertible notes maturing on May 1, 2025, with cash on hand.

Long-Range Growth Plan

The Long-Range Plan builds upon the successful execution of the previous three years. NeoGenomics intends to achieve the following:

  • 12-13% revenue growth annually, including NGS growth of ~25% per year2
  • Gross margin expansion of 100-150 bps per year
  • Adjusted EBITDA improvement of 250-300 bps per year
  • Positive cash flow from operations in 2025 and beyond
  • Serving more than 1 million patients annually by 2028 and beyond
